Boyd Mwila’s three first half goals, all within 15 minutes, led road attack for Orgryte in a 3-1 victory at Degerfors.
The former Chiparamba Great Eagles striker opened the scoring in the 25th minute as he was able to run onto the end of a longball from teammate Pavel Zavadil and slot the ball inside the left post.
It was only a mere four minutes later when former Swedish International Marcus Allback found and open Mwila off a free-kick, which Boyd calmly finished.
Ten minutes later, he finished off his hat-trick, capitalizing on a mistake by the defensive unit of the home-side, finishing off his 6th goal of the season.
Consequently Mwila, who was part of the national squad as a 20-year old from 2004-2005, won man of the match honours.
The Swedish leagues are on break until mid-october, with 20 of 30 games gone in the season, Orgryte have a 2 point-lead in first place, and are tipped to win promotion back into the Allsvenskan for next season.
